1. A method of retrieving location data using a print medium, the method comprising steps of:

  • sensing a coded data portion encoded on a surface of the print medium using a sensor module when the sensor module is positioned on the surface, the surface having a plurality of coded data portions encoded thereon, each coded data portion encoding at least a print media identifier which identifies the print medium and a two-dimensional coordinate grid position of the coded data portion on the surface of the print medium;

    determining the print media identifier from the coded data sensed by the sensor module;

    determining the two-dimensional coordinate grid position of the coded data portion sensed by the sensor module from the coded data;

    retrieving from a database location data referenced by the print media identifier and a region on the surface of the print medium, the two-dimensional coordinate grid position of the coded data portion sensed by the sensor module being within said region.
